WebIATP ATLOAN$ - The Program is restricted to Illinois residents with disabilities, 18 years and older. The loan can be used to purchase assistive technology devices and limited home modifications. ATLOAN$ can range from $250 to $30,000.00. WebStatewide- Financing and Home Repairs. Manufactured Housing: Champlain Housing Trust also offers a Manufactured Housing Down Payment Loan Program, which assists mobile home owners purchase or replace their mobile home with an Energy Star rated manufactured home.
